Understanding Loss Aversion
Loss aversion is a significant concept in gambling psychology, referring to the tendency for individuals to prefer avoiding losses over acquiring equivalent gains. In casinos, this principle plays a critical role in player behavior. For instance, when players experience a loss, they often double down on their bets in an effort to recover their losses. This can lead to an endless cycle of chasing losses, where players become trapped in a mindset that fuels further gambling.
This concept is closely tied to the emotional reactions players experience while gambling. A player who loses may feel an acute sense of disappointment or frustration, driving them to take more risks to regain what they lost. This emotional cycle can create a paradox where the player feels they have to continue gambling not just for the potential of winning, but also to escape the negative feelings associated with losing.
Moreover, casinos often employ strategies that capitalize on loss aversion. For example, they provide players with bonuses or loyalty rewards that create a sense of investment in their gameplay. These incentives can trick players into thinking they are ahead, even if they are operating at a loss. The Role of Social Influence
Social influence is another powerful factor in player behavior within casinos. Many people gamble in groups or as part of a social outing, which can significantly affect their decision-making processes. Observing others winning or losing can create a bandwagon effect, where individuals feel compelled to join in on the action to fit in or because they believe that the excitement is contagious. This social dynamic can enhance the thrill of gambling and encourage continued play.
Furthermore, the presence of peers can amplify emotions related to both winning and losing. When players experience a win, the shared joy with friends can enhance their feelings of elation, making them more likely to continue playing. Conversely, if a player sees a friend lose, they may feel a strong urge to comfort them or join in on the next game to lift spirits, perpetuating the cycle of gambling. This peer pressure can encourage decisions that might not be made in solitary play.
Additionally, the rise of online casinos has transformed social influence dynamics. Platforms often incorporate social features, allowing players to share wins or achievements with friends. This sense of community can further drive engagement as individuals feel connected to others while participating in gambling activities. The Impact of Cognitive Biases
Cognitive biases play a significant role in shaping player behavior in casinos. Many players fall prey to the gambler’s fallacy, believing that past events can influence future outcomes. For example, if a slot machine has not paid out for several rounds, players may think they are due for a win, leading them to invest more money than they initially intended. This irrational thinking can be detrimental, as it distorts their understanding of probability and increases the likelihood of financial loss.
Additionally, confirmation bias can lead players to focus on their successes while ignoring losses. When a player wins, they may remember that experience vividly and use it to justify their gambling habits, while conveniently forgetting the times they lost. This selective memory creates an inflated perception of winning, reinforcing their desire to gamble despite the odds being against them. Understanding these biases is essential for both players and casinos to foster a responsible gambling environment.
Moreover, the design of games and the casino layout often exploit these biases. Casinos are intentionally designed to encourage gambling behavior, with bright lights and sounds that signal wins, no matter how small. This stimulates the brain’s reward pathways, leading to a perception of frequent success even when overall outcomes are negative.
